Shop doors - prospective London mayors agree, but powerless

I wrote my concern about the unnecessary damage of open shop doors to the three main candidates for London Mayor. Brian Paddick answered first (by email) saying that he agreed, but such legislation was not in the Mayor's power. Then answered Ken Livingstone's office, saying also that such legislation was not in the Mayor's power. Finally, I received a letter from Boris Johnson's office, with a vague agreement that London should become greener.

We now have a new London Mayor; let us see.
